      It doesn't need to be anyone special. Aizawa is just something to resemble the final challenge Kiryu had in 5. Aizawa is the past Kiryu already had a fight with. The dream of the Tojo, the true gokudos he battled with, the world itself against what Kiryu beliefs. He is a koi, same as Nishiki. Again trying to defeat a dragon, again trying to pick the top of a wall he isn't even sure he can climb. It didn't need to be him but picking him is perfect. Kiryu is fighting two battles he already fought, he already made his point in almost all the games, he even had to proof against the mirror image of his father and he already defeated a koi.
      Aizawa is great, I know people meme a lot with him saying "I not even sure myself" but in the same sentence he explains very well and makes sense with Yakuza 5 thematic as whole. Kurosawa wanted to make his power something material, he didn't recognize that in fact he had a dream and wanted to project in some way even if means putting his son as the representation. Aizawa dreams of being something real, having power, becoming a legend in his own way. Is a battle of dreams for everyone but Kiryu. Haruka finishing Parks dream, Saejima and Majima finally enjoying each other again, Shinada saving someone who has something he always dreamed of, Akiyama fighting for the place he always dreams of becoming a better place, etc. He is the perfect final boss, he is all the fights Kiryu had, all the fights the player already won asking one more time if we really had won and we literally throw this question away. Is in the same way Kurosawa is an amazing final antagonist being someone who just rejects the concept of the games in general.
